The Township Committee is voting to decide the fate of their volunteer emergency medical technicians who provide medical services to the residents of the Township of Green Brook and mutual aid assistance to surrounding communities evenings from 6pm to 3am and full weekends. They claim that they need to save money yet have been very generous in giving 2 department heads raises and back pay, Our entire budget was their compensation. We have provided other support for community events which are services that a paid service will not provide for and if needed somebody will get their bill. The paid service will directly bill their patients approximately $600 per call far more then the small amount of tax dollars it takes to keep our service free, which only amounts to approximately .03 cents on the dollar.
